The model showcases a T-profile concrete beam reinforced with tendons, designed to support a concrete slab. Such reinforcement is crucial for ensuring the structural integrity and load-bearing capacity required in construction projects. The integration of tendons helps in maintaining the tension and compression balance within the beam structure. This model serves as a representative example for analyzing prestressed concrete beams.
